How to Cook Salmon on a Griddle
How to Cook Salmon on a Griddle

How to Cook Salmon on a Griddle

September 1, 2021 By Shalyn Leave a Comment

Griddles are the best if you want to make breakfast meals such as toasted sandwiches and pancakes. However, they are also great cooking appliances when you want to cook fish. Salmon is firm and tender and it does not release a lot of juices when you cook, thus you don’t need to contain it in the high sides of a skillet.

You can cook salmon on a flat griddle to attain a flawless pink exterior or use a ridged griddle to create luscious dark grill stripes across the top of the fish. Method for cooking fried salmon

You will require the following to cook fried salmon on a griddle:

Equipment and utensils

  • Griddle
  • Tongs
  • Silicone spatula

Ingredients

  • Fresh salmon
  • Salt
  • Pepper
  • Olive oil spray
  • Lemon juice

Step 1

Season both sides of the salmon with salt and pepper. Pat the seasoning gently into the salmon with your fingers. Wash your hands thoroughly with soap and hot water afterwards.

Step 2

Switch on your griddle and allow it to heat to medium high. Use a spritz bottle with water to check if your griddle is hot enough, if it evaporates quickly then you are good to go. Spray your griddle with a light spritz of oil spray. Any non-stick spray will work, but olive oil adds a bit of flavour.

Step 3

Place the salmon on the griddle with the skin side up. Cook the fish for 3 to 5 minutes. Slide a spatula under the fish and carefully free it from the griddle. Flip it over so that the skin is now side down.

Step 4

Sprinkle a bit of lemon juice over the fish. Be careful to ensure that it does not splatter you when it gets in contact with the hot griddle. Season your salmon with spices of your choice. Some of the spices that compliment salmon include thyme, sage, and lemon pepper.

Step 5

Cook the fish for another 3 to 5 minutes, or a total of 10 minutes per inch of thickness. The salmon is done when it is opaque and it flakes easily with a fork.

Method for cooking salmon with tomatoes, olives, and French beans

You will require the following to cook salmon with tomatoes, olives, and French beans salmon on a griddle:

Equipment and utensils

  •         Griddle
  •         Tongs
  •         Silicone spatula

Ingredients

  • Fresh salmon
  • Salt
  • Pepper
  • Olive oil spray
  • Tomatoes
  • Olives
  • French beans
  • Basil

Step 1

Start your griddle preheated to medium high and brush with olive oil

Step 2

Place the fish skin-side up and griddle for 3 to 5 minutes

Step 3

Carefully, flip the fish onto the skin side. While it is cooking for another 3 to 5 minutes, add your tomatoes, French beans, and olives. Gently, stir them around the edges of the fish to ensure that they cook simultaneously. You still want a little texture to the veggies, hence the short cooking time

Step 4

Plate up a salmon and top with the vegetable mixture. You may figure that the veggies need another couple of minutes on the griddle once you have removed the salmon.

Step 5

Sprinkle with the chopped fresh basil and serve

What is the best temperature to cook salmon on a griddle?

The ideal temperature for cooking salmon on a griddle is on a medium-high heat. For you to know if the griddle is hot enough, you need to add a drop of water to the griddle. If it sizzles and evaporates, the griddle is ready and you can start cooking.

How long does it take to cook salmon on a griddle?

You need to cook salmon for around 3 to 5 minutes on each side to cook a regular-sized salmon fillet, for it to be thoroughly cooked. However, if you are worried about undercooking or overcooking your salmon, there is a more precise method that you can use. For every inch of thickness for the fillet, you are required to cook it for 10 minutes.

It is important to check the cooking time of your fish before you begin your cooking process. If you are serving the fish with carbs, these will take longer to cook compared to your fish. It is important to ensure that your food cooks at the same time, to avoid the need to reheat.

What is good to season salmon with?

For a basic salmon fillet, you need salt and pepper on both sides. This helps to bring out the flavour of the salmon. Other seasonings that you can add include ginger, soy sauce, lemon juice, garlic powder, fresh herbs, and dried herbs.

Tips

  • If you use soy sauce to cook your salmon, ensure that you hold the salt
  • Do not use a fork to turn the salmon because it might fall apart when cooked thoroughly
